Frequently Asked Questions about Brookline
How much are Studio apartments in Brookline?
There are currently 1,967 Studio Apartments in Brookline with rent ranges from $1,500 to $9,800 with an average price of $2,490.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Brookline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Brookline ranges from $920 to $10,364 with an average monthly rent of $3,038.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Brookline c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Brookline range from $1,301 to $13,912.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,747.
How expensive are Brookline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 2,614 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Brookline on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$890 to $19,690 - averaging $4,383 for the location.
